Summary of differences between Pigeon pea raw and Caviar

  • Pigeon pea raw has more Copper, Folate, Manganese, and Fiber, while Caviar has more Vitamin B12, Selenium, Iron, and Vitamin B5.
  • Caviar covers your daily need of Vitamin B12 833% more than Pigeon pea raw.
  • The amount of Sodium in Pigeon pea raw is lower.

These are the specific foods used in this comparison Pigeon peas (red gram), mature seeds, raw and Fish, caviar, black and red, granular.

All nutrients comparison - raw data values

Nutrient Pigeon pea raw Caviar Opinion
Net carbs 47.78g 4g Pigeon pea raw
Protein 21.7g 24.6g Caviar
Fats 1.49g 17.9g Caviar
Carbs 62.78g 4g Pigeon pea raw
Calories 343kcal 264kcal Pigeon pea raw
Fiber 15g 0g Pigeon pea raw
Calcium 130mg 275mg Caviar
Iron 5.23mg 11.88mg Caviar
Magnesium 183mg 300mg Caviar
Phosphorus 367mg 356mg Pigeon pea raw
Potassium 1392mg 181mg Pigeon pea raw
Sodium 17mg 1500mg Pigeon pea raw
Zinc 2.76mg 0.95mg Pigeon pea raw
Copper 1.057mg 0.11mg Pigeon pea raw
Manganese 1.791mg 0.05mg Pigeon pea raw
Selenium 8.2µg 65.5µg Caviar
Vitamin A 28IU 905IU Caviar
Vitamin A RAE 1µg 271µg Caviar
Vitamin E 1.89mg Caviar
Vitamin D 0IU 117IU Caviar
Vitamin D 0µg 2.9µg Caviar
Vitamin B1 0.643mg 0.19mg Pigeon pea raw
Vitamin B2 0.187mg 0.62mg Caviar
Vitamin B3 2.965mg 0.12mg Pigeon pea raw
Vitamin B5 1.266mg 3.5mg Caviar
Vitamin B6 0.283mg 0.32mg Caviar
Folate 456µg 50µg Pigeon pea raw
Vitamin B12 0µg 20µg Caviar
Vitamin K 0.6µg Caviar
Tryptophan 0.212mg 0.323mg Caviar
Threonine 0.767mg 1.263mg Caviar
Isoleucine 0.785mg 1.035mg Caviar
Leucine 1.549mg 2.133mg Caviar
Lysine 1.521mg 1.834mg Caviar
Methionine 0.243mg 0.646mg Caviar
Phenylalanine 1.858mg 1.071mg Pigeon pea raw
Valine 0.937mg 1.263mg Caviar
Histidine 0.774mg 0.649mg Pigeon pea raw
Cholesterol 0mg 588mg Pigeon pea raw
Saturated Fat 0.33g 4.06g Pigeon pea raw
Omega-3 - DHA 3.8g Caviar
Omega-3 - EPA 2.741g Caviar
Omega-3 - DPA 0.229g Caviar
Monounsaturated Fat 0.012g 4.631g Caviar
Polyunsaturated fat 0.814g 7.405g Caviar
